Digitally remastered two-fer containing a pair of albums from the Country icon. With a voice closer to Bonnie Raitt than any other Country vocalist, Lacy could be described as the female version of Waylon Jennings. 16th Avenue was released in 1982. The title track, surprisingly, only reached #7 in the Billboard Country charts. It has since been hailed as one of the all-time great Country records and is the song most associated with Lacy J. The other track released as a single was 'Slow Down' which reached #13. Takin' It Easy was released in 1981 and reached #12 in the Billboard Country album charts and remained there for 39 weeks. The singles taken from the album were the title track which got to #2 and a double A-side of 'Everybody Makes Mistakes/Wild Turkey' which reached #5. Amazingly, Lacy only won one major award (Academy of Country Music's Top New Female Vocalist in 1980) but awards mean nothing as those with ears will know. Here is one of the greatest, smoky-voiced Honky Tonk singers of all time.
